Love Island airs on different services depending on where you live, and the official editions are typically streamed on the broadcaster’s own app or a dedicated subscription platform in each market. In the United Kingdom, the show is broadcast by ITV and streams on ITVX with an active television license and active subscription where required. In the United States, the reality series streams on Peacock, which carries several seasons and recent episodes depending on your Peacock subscription tier and regional availability. Availability can also differ in Canada, Australia, and other regions, often tied to local broadcasters and their streaming services or licensed partners.

Platform Details and Viewing Options
ITVX (United Kingdom)
ITVX is the streaming service for ITV in the United Kingdom, and it hosts Love Island when the show is in season or available for catch-up. Access usually requires a television license, and some content may be behind a premium tier depending on the edition. The platform offers both live streams of episodes and on-demand viewing once they air.
Peacock (United States)
Peacock is the primary U.S. streaming home for Love Island in many recent seasons, providing episodes on demand. The availability of each season can depend on your subscription type, such as Peacock Premium or Premium Plus, and some older seasons may be rotated out over time. Ads may appear on the lower tiers, while higher tiers offer an uninterrupted experience and offline downloads.

Digital Purchases and Rentals
In some regions, episodes or seasons may be available to buy or rent through digital stores such as Apple TV, Google Play, Amazon Prime Video, or YouTube. These options are useful if you do not have a subscription to the primary streaming service, though they can be more expensive per season than an ongoing streaming membership. Availability for purchase can vary by store and country, so it is wise to compare options before committing.
